Вопрос задан 19.09.2018 в 17:50. Предмет Информатика. Спрашивает Люлин Илья.

Задумано целое число от нуля до ста.Какое наименьшее число вопросов надо задать,чтобы угадать это

число ?
0 0
Перейти к ответам

Ответы на вопрос

Внимание! Ответы на вопросы дают живые люди. Они могут содержать ошибочную информацию, заблуждения, а также ответы могут быть сгенерированы нейросетями. Будьте внимательны. Если вы уверены, что ответ неверный, нажмите кнопку "Пожаловаться" под ответом.
Отвечает Бебякина Лиза.
1 вопрос загадано число больше 50? Нет 2 вопрос загадано число больше 25? Нет 3 вопрос загадано число больше 15? Нет 4 вопрос загадано число больше 12? Да 5 вопрос загадано число больше 13? Нет Это число 13 !
0 0
Отвечает нейросеть ChatGpt. Будьте внимательны, ответы нейросети могут содержать ошибочные или выдуманные данные.

Для того чтобы угадать целое число от нуля до ста, наименьшее количество вопросов, которое нужно задать, можно определить, используя метод двоичного поиска.

Метод двоичного поиска

Метод двоичного поиска позволяет эффективно находить искомое число, задавая минимальное количество вопросов. Он основан на делении интервала возможных значений пополам и последующем сужении интервала в зависимости от ответа на вопрос.

1. Начнем с интервала от 0 до 100. 2. Зададим вопрос: "Это число больше 50?" Если ответ "да", то искомое число находится в интервале от 51 до 100. Если ответ "нет", то искомое число находится в интервале от 0 до 50. 3. Затем зададим вопрос, делая новое деление пополам в соответствующем интервале. Например, если предыдущий интервал был от 51 до 100, то зададим вопрос: "Это число больше 75?" И так далее. 4. Продолжаем задавать вопросы и сужать интервал до тех пор, пока не угадаем число.

Используя метод двоичного поиска, наименьшее количество вопросов, которое нужно задать, равно количеству делений пополам, пока не будет угадано число. В данном случае, для угадывания числа от 0 до 100, это будет максимум 7 вопросов.

Пример вопросов

Вот пример вопросов, которые можно задать, используя метод двоичного поиска:

1. Вопрос: "Это число больше 50?" (ответ "да") 2. Вопрос: "Это число больше 75?" (ответ "нет") 3. Вопрос: "Это число больше 62?" (ответ "да") 4. Вопрос: "Это число больше 68?" (ответ "нет") 5. Вопрос: "Это число больше 65?" (ответ "да") 6. Вопрос: "Это число больше 66?" (ответ "нет") 7. Вопрос: "Это число равно 65?" (ответ "да")

Итак, наименьшее количество вопросов, которое нужно задать, чтобы угадать целое число от нуля до ста, составляет максимум 7 вопросов.

0 0

Топ вопросов за вчера в категории Информатика

Последние заданные вопросы в категории Информатика

Задать вопрос